web-dev-qa-db-fra.com

RTSP h.264 dans le navigateur Google Chrome

Après nous passons à html5 et à de nombreux navigateurs tels que Google chrome bans plugin Web VLC. ...

Est-il possible de lire les flux RTSP h.264/h.265 dans les navigateurs actuels?

13
Stweet

La diffusion directe en RTSP n’est toujours pas prise en charge par les navigateurs. Si vous devez lire un flux RTSP dans le navigateur, vous avez besoin d’un serveur proxy qui convertit le flux RTSP en flux HTTP.

Il existe de nombreux projets open source qui effectueront le travail de conversion RTSP en HTTP ou vous pouvez utiliser FFmpeg (utilisé par VLC) pour convertir RTSP en HTTP et les diffuser ensuite sur le navigateur.

13
Mohd Asim Suhail

Ces gars-là mettent en place un RTSP sur Websocket Player . https://github.com/Streamedian/html5_rtsp_player

Mais il faut un serveur pour créer la connexion et analyser les informations rtsp (elles incluent un paquet facile à installer pour s’occuper de cela). 

Et il ne supporte pas h265.

3
Victor.dMdB

Comme mentionné précédemment, vous ne pouvez pas jouer à RTSP de manière native sur aucun navigateur. Si votre source est strictement RTSP, vous pouvez utiliser un serveur proxy entre votre serveur RTSP et votre navigateur. Vous pouvez utiliser le serveur proxy WebRTC pour lire RTP sur les navigateurs compatibles WebRTC. http://webrtc.live555.com/

2
Alam

vous pouvez utiliser VXG Media Plugin pour Chrome Formats vidéo pris en charge: H.264, MPEG-4, MPEG-2 et autres . vous pouvez trouver le document complet sur ce plugin à partir du lien indiqué ci-dessous https://www.videoexpertsgroup.com/vxg-chrome-plugin/

https://www.videoexpertsgroup.com/nacl_player_api/#examples

1
Hitesh Tripathi